have 3560's with a bunch of 7941s and PCs hanging off the phones.  All
ports configured the same (portfast, bpduguard, etc).

I have this one guy that at least once a day, his port shuts off, goes into
err-disable.  Sometimes it's in that state when he comes in in the morning,
other times it will be that way when he comes back from lunch.  It does not
seem to happen when he is working on his PC.

Happened again today, so I went in the 3560, did a "shut" followed by "no
shut".  The port went connected and a few seconds later, right back to
err-disable.  I did it several times, and each time, immediately the port
went back to err-disable.  I finally drove over there, and with just the
phone, the port stayed up.  plug in the PC, and the port will err-disable.
I removed some junk ware from his PC and cranked up the AV and Spyware
protection, will see what happens.

Do you think it might be the phone's bridge?  Flaky switch port (doubtful
today I moved him to a new port and again, it immed went to err-dis).  When
I do the "show err-dis reason" (I know it's not reason, I forget the
syntax), the reason listed is "bpduguard".  How the heck do I trip a
bpduguard with just a phone and PC?  have swapped out the cables too....

Just looking for some insight!  Next will be a new NIC card and running a
new cable from the data room to his office.
